Amiga 3000 Hard drive problem
« on: April 25, 2016, 12:31:08 PM »
Hello,

I have set up a 1GB Scsi HDD within WinUAE. All works fine.

But when I put the drive into the Amiga 3000, it powers up, but does not spin.

It`s still fine in the PC with WinUAE, and other hard drives are fine in the Amiga.

Any ideas?

Simon

Is the master/slave jumper in the correct position if its an IDE? If its SCSI is it terminated correctly and set to the correct ID (not conflicting with another device in your 3000)?

Sounds like the CD drive was the end and termination is on. If you find out how to terminate the drive you can remove the CD drive or attach an active terminator in the CD drives place.
